MySQL是一個(gè)開(kāi)源的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),被廣泛應(yīng)用于網(wǎng)站開(kāi)發(fā)、數(shù)據(jù)分析、數(shù)據(jù)存儲(chǔ)等領(lǐng)域。而MySQL mhanode則是一種基于MySQL的高可用性解決方案,能夠保證數(shù)據(jù)庫(kù)的持續(xù)可用性和數(shù)據(jù)一致性。
+---------------------+ +----------------------+ | MySQL Master Server | | MySQL Slave Server 1 | +---------------------+ +----------------------+ ^ ^ | | +------------------------------+ | | +---------------------------+ | MySQL Slave Server 2 | +---------------------------+
MySQL mhanode采用的是主從復(fù)制的方式,將主庫(kù)的數(shù)據(jù)同步到備庫(kù)中,以確保數(shù)據(jù)的備份和容錯(cuò)。同時(shí),當(dāng)主庫(kù)發(fā)生宕機(jī)等異常情況時(shí),自動(dòng)將備庫(kù)提升為主庫(kù),保證數(shù)據(jù)庫(kù)的高可用性。
在實(shí)際應(yīng)用中,為了確保mhanode的可靠性和高可用性,需要采取一些措施,如:
- 采用異地備份,將備庫(kù)放在不同的機(jī)房,保證備庫(kù)的容錯(cuò)性
- 定期進(jìn)行備份,以防數(shù)據(jù)丟失
- 監(jiān)控主、備庫(kù)的運(yùn)行狀況,及時(shí)發(fā)現(xiàn)并處理異常
總之,MySQL mhanode是一種可靠的數(shù)據(jù)庫(kù)高可用性解決方案,通過(guò)主從復(fù)制的方式,保證數(shù)據(jù)庫(kù)的持續(xù)可用性和數(shù)據(jù)一致性。但在實(shí)際應(yīng)用中,還需采取一些措施來(lái)確保其可靠性和安全性。